A CCTV appeal has been launched after skincare products were stolen from the Superdrug store in Potters Bar.
The incident occurred around 11.50am on Thursday, March 21, when it is reported that the products were taken from the Darkes Lane shop without payment.
"Is this you, or do you recognise the person?," said PCSO Christopher Ramdeen, from the Potters Bar and Shenley Neighbourhood Policing Team.
